Pressure washing is commonly made use of to tidy structures, smooth surface areas and equipment on campus. Stress cleaning can adversely affect water high quality if not done properly. Usage completely dry techniques such as mops, blowers or street sweepers to cleanse the location prior to making use of a pressure washing machine on any type of surface. Block off storm drains initially to protect against particles from getting in.

EHS has actually typically found that using chemicals does not boost the outcome. Cost financial savings can be substantial without the use of chemicals, since the wastewater usually does not require to be captured and transferred to a disposal facility. If a chemical cleaner must be made use of for pressure cleaning, take the complying with actions: Contact EHS to get a map of the tornado drains pipes around the project site.


This can entail tarps, berms, tornado drainpipe covers or mats, pipeline plugs, pumps, and so on. The other alternative is to collect the wastewater in a drum or container and remove offsite for disposal at a licensed wastewater center.

Pressure washing in some places need additional precautions to guarantee that the materials being washed do not get in the tornado drainpipe system.

Drainage from those locations need to be recorded and not enabled to release into storm drains pipes. Oil and food waste that splashes or sprinkles onto the ground must be cleaned using completely dry approaches such as absorbing materials or shop vacs. If degreaser will certainly be needed, contact EHS for assist with a clean-up strategy that will certainly include obstructing the tornado drains pipes and accumulating wastewater.



Packing dock trench drains pipes and floor drains attached to the storm drainpipe system: Do not stress wash oil or food waste off of these filling docks. If pressure cleaning is required to clean spills, get in touch with EHS for a clean-up strategy that will entail blocking the drains pipes and collecting wastewater.
